V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
Livid
V2EX  ›  macOS

~/Developer

  •  2
     
  •   Livid · 2022-03-12 03:21:20 +08:00 · 5535 次点击
    这是一个创建于 1017 天前的主题,其中的信息可能已经有所发展或是发生改变。

    如果你在 macOS 的用户 Home Directory 下面建立一个叫做 Developer 的文件夹,你会发现这个文件夹具有一个特殊的图标。

    这个其实是以前版本的 macOS 留下的一个特性——因为那里曾经是开发者工具的安装位置。

    虽然后来 Xcode 也变成安装在 /Applications 下,但是这个特殊属性的目录还是继续保留了下来,在最新的 Monterey 里也依然有效。

    如果你不想把那种文件很多的软件项目目录(比如那些有 node_modules 的)放进会被 iCloud 同步的地方,那么 ~/Developer 会是一个很适合的地方。

    25 条回复    2023-10-11 21:20:08 +08:00
    czhu
        1
    czhu  
       2022-03-12 03:42:03 +08:00
    如何把这个有特殊图标的 Developer 也加入到 iCloud 里 实现自动同步和备份?
    dingwen07
        2
    dingwen07  
       2022-03-12 03:44:22 +08:00 via iPhone
    所有开发相关内容都在里面,主目录很干净
    感觉唯一不太好的是这个目录没有本地化,即使添加了.localized ,也不会变成中文
    dingwen07
        3
    dingwen07  
       2022-03-12 03:44:45 +08:00 via iPhone
    @czhu #1 链接到 iCloud Drive 应该可以
    czhu
        4
    czhu  
       2022-03-12 03:59:00 +08:00
    @dingwen07 好像不行哎
    philon
        5
    philon  
       2022-03-12 09:19:27 +08:00   ❤️ 2
    还有~/Sites
    varzy
        6
    varzy  
       2022-03-12 09:34:44 +08:00
    因为这个图标,我一直都把所有工程放到这个文件夹下面,:D
    sickoo
        7
    sickoo  
       2022-03-12 09:55:05 +08:00
    小彩蛋。
    atone
        8
    atone  
       2022-03-12 10:46:03 +08:00
    我也是把所有的开发项目放在这个文件夹下的
    sobigfish
        9
    sobigfish  
       2022-03-12 12:57:03 +08:00
    我以前是用~/dev 就因为 developer 有自带图标,才又 mv 到~/Developer 目前目录大小 47GB😂
    musi
        10
    musi  
       2022-03-12 13:53:28 +08:00
    @philon #5 我发现我创建了~/Sites 文件夹后不能直接在 Finder 中把这个目录移动到废纸篓了
    terrytang1
        11
    terrytang1  
       2022-03-12 14:52:48 +08:00
    我空间太小了,开发项目直接就放到外接 ssd 了
    szzhiyang
        12
    szzhiyang  
       2022-03-12 22:21:25 +08:00
    我的项目都放在 src 目录下,路径简短方便手打。😂
    beginor
        13
    beginor  
       2022-03-13 06:57:29 +08:00 via Android
    ~/Applications 又是什么梗呢?
    sobigfish
        14
    sobigfish  
       2022-03-13 10:58:50 +08:00
    @beginor ~/Applications 就是用户独占的 app 目录啊,但 Mac 一般都是单用户在用 所以 app 都是默认放在 /Applications 里
    superrichman
        15
    superrichman  
       2022-03-13 11:20:11 +08:00
    这个特殊图标行为是系统有一个固定的路径列表吗?还是跟 windows 一样可以用类似 desktop.ini 来自定义的?
    dingwen07
        16
    dingwen07  
       2022-03-13 11:44:00 +08:00
    @superrichman #15
    有固定的路径
    在磁盘根目录和用户主目录下有效应该是
    ShuoHui
        17
    ShuoHui  
       2022-03-13 11:49:27 +08:00 via iPhone
    学 swift 时候有个教程说有这个 Dic ,结果没找到,新建了一个发现图标还在,后来 Xcode 项目都放里面
    mikewang
        18
    mikewang  
       2022-03-13 13:05:58 +08:00   ❤️ 4
    曾尝试过使用 ~/Developer ,后来发现有点点碍事:
    原本输入 cd De[tab] 就能切到桌面
    现在要多输一个字符ε-(´∀`; )
    fihserman123
        19
    fihserman123  
       2022-03-13 14:39:17 +08:00
    @mikewang 哈哈 我马上想到了这个担忧
    yanbo92
        20
    yanbo92  
       2022-03-13 14:48:32 +08:00
    好家伙 学习了
    xtinput
        21
    xtinput  
       2022-03-13 23:02:15 +08:00
    好吧,难道就我一个是丢桌面的?以前用 win 的时候桌面一个图标都不会放,更别说文件了,后来用 macOS ,因它不分区公司项目自己的项目等等划分,几个文件夹直接就丢桌面了。
    然后 macOS 分区格式升级到 APFS ,那就更没必要动了,很喜欢 write to copy ,拷贝文件只有在原文件修改的时候才会产生新的空间占用,如果不修改只是多了个索引
    pcmid
        22
    pcmid  
       2022-03-14 04:07:10 +08:00 via iPhone
    @mikewang #17 哈哈,我使用 linux 也碰到了这个,后来我做了一个 alias cdd 直接 cd 到桌面
    cco
        23
    cco  
       2022-03-15 10:26:56 +08:00
    我是直接在~目录下,反正 IDE 自己创建的,懒得改
    HackerJax
        24
    HackerJax  
       2022-03-18 11:58:42 +08:00
    为什么我的 home 目录一个有图标的目录都没有呢?
    bro
        25
    bro  
       2023-10-11 21:20:08 +08:00 via Android
    ~/Sites 也自带图标
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   5643 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 26ms · UTC 06:03 · PVG 14:03 · LAX 22:03 · JFK 01:03
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.